Battery Disconnect and Connect
For information on Ford Color Coded Illustrations refer to OEM Color Coding
Disconnect
NOTE:
When the battery is disconnected and connected, some abnormal drive symptoms may occur while the vehicle relearns its adaptive strategy. The vehicle may need to be driven to allow the PCM to relearn the adaptive strategy values.
NOTE:
The following 2 steps are for disconnecting the negative battery cable to interrupt power to the vehicle electrical system. It is not necessary to disconnect the positive battery cable.
- Remove the retainers and the battery cover.
- Loosen the nut and position the negative battery cable.
Torque: 44 lb.in (5 Nm)
- Position the positive battery cable cover, loosen the nut and position the positive battery cable.
Torque: 44 lb.in (5 Nm)
Connect
- To connect, reverse the disconnect procedure.
